Idebenone CAS# 58186-27-9
1. Solubility & Stability:
It is highly soluble in DMSO and organic solvents but not in water. It remains stable for a year and is suitable for storage in low temperatures.
2. Chemical Properties:
Idebenone is orange-colored and has a low melting point. It dissolves well in a variety of organic solvents but is insoluble in water.
3. Applications:
Used in pharmaceuticals for its antioxidant properties, mitochondrial support, and possible treatments for neurodegenerative conditions. It also has cosmetic uses.
4. Safety:
Classified as an irritant (Xi), it must be handled with care to avoid skin or eye irritation, requiring protective measures during research or formulation.
Idebenone is a yellow crystalline or powdered substance with no detectable odor. It has extremely low solubility in water but dissolves readily in chloroform, methanol, or anhydrous ethanol. It is also soluble in ethyl acetate but insoluble in *n*-hexane.
